Disability ramp repair services focus on restoring or improving existing ramps to ensure they remain safe and accessible for individuals with mobility challenges. These services typically involve fixing structural issues such as loose or damaged handrails, cracked or unstable surfaces, and compromised support posts. Repair work may also include replacing worn or broken components to prevent accidents and maintain compliance with accessibility standards. The goal is to enhance the safety, stability, and functionality of ramps used for wheelchair access, scooter mobility, or for those with difficulty navigating stairs.

Addressing common problems like deterioration due to weather exposure, heavy usage, or aging helps prevent safety hazards that could lead to falls or injuries. Over time, ramps may develop uneven surfaces, loose fittings, or weakened structural elements, which can impede mobility or pose risks to users. Repair services aim to resolve these issues promptly, ensuring that ramps remain reliable and accessible for daily use.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of a ramp and help property owners avoid more costly replacements in the future.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for disability ramp repairs typically ranges from $200 to $1,000, depending on the type and quality of materials used. For example, basic aluminum or wood components tend to be on the lower end, while specialized or durable materials may be more expensive.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for ramp repair services usually fall between $300 and $1,500, influenced by the complexity of the repair and local labor rates. Simple fixes might cost around $300, whereas extensive repairs can reach closer to $1,500 or more.

Additional Fees - Additional charges such as permits, site preparation, or disposal fees can add $50 to $300 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on local regulations and the scope of work involved in the repair project.

Overall Project Costs - Overall expenses for disability ramp repairs typically range from $550 to $2,800, with the total depending on materials, labor, and any extra fees.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ific repair need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
